This Is Beautiful Red Wine, Which Is Best Enjoyed

This is beautiful red wine, which is best enjoyed with red meats and spicy/peppery dishes, although it is also very nice on its own, perhaps accompanied by some of your favourite cheeses. The full bodied and spicy Shiraz mixes well with the Cabernet and make this a great red wine blend, rich and flavoursome and full bodied. At £7.00 a bottle this is a bit more expensive than your average supermarket Shiraz, but for the quality it's worth it.
